diff --git a/docs/development.md b/docs/development.md index d82a3b29f1409b366a148d3ec87fd3a53b79c186..1a6b05f510ea12557403786b6e3548cbff79956b 100644 --- a/docs/development.md +++ b/docs/development.md @@ -1,6 +1,6 @@

开发指南

-

开发工具

+

开发工具及相关软件

JDK 1.8 + @@ -12,6 +12,12 @@ Tomcat 9 + MySQL Server 5.5 + +kafka 2.5.0 + + +Redis 6 + + +OpenLDAP 2.2 + +

程序目录

@@ -69,12 +75,54 @@ MySQL Server 5.5 + JAVA集成使用SDK + + + maxkey-connectors + + + 身份供应连接器 + + + + + maxkey-connector-activedirectory + + ActiveDirectory连接器 + + + + + maxkey-connector-base + + 身份供应连接器接口 + + + + + maxkey-connector-ldap + + LDAP连接器 + + + + + maxkey-connector-dingtalk + + 钉钉连接器 + + + + + maxkey-connector-workweixin + + 企业微信连接器 + maxkey-core - 基础 + 基础包 @@ -83,6 +131,27 @@ MySQL Server 5.5 + 数据库访问 + + + maxkey-identitys + + + 身份管理 + + + + + maxkey-identity-kafka + + kafka身份同步 + + + + + maxkey-identity-scim + + SCIM2.0身份管理 + maxkey-lib @@ -227,6 +296,33 @@ MySQL Server 5.5 + +

工程构建BuildRelease

+ +1. 配置环境变量 + +gradleSetEnv.bat + +set JAVA_HOME=D:\JavaIDE\jdk1.8.0_91 + +set GRADLE_HOME=D:\JavaIDE\gradle-5.4.1 + + +2. 启动构建 + +gradleBuildRelease.bat + + +3. 构建结果 + +构建包路径 + +MaxKey/build/maxkey-jars + +依赖包路径 + +MaxKey/build/maxkey-depjars + +

问题及解决

问题1